Santa Rosa - and all of NorCal for that matter - has a rich history with frame builders. From Eisentraut to Salsa, Sycip, and Retrotec, the names and faces of this little realm within the cycling industry have such great stories to tell. While I'm working on a few more posts from my recent trip to Santa Rosa, I thought I'd share this unique build with you. High in the rafters at Trail House hangs this 1990's Kostrikin rigid single speed mountain bike. These days, bikes like this are still…

Rigid bikes. The roots of riding off-road, yet now the arena of weirdos, quacks, and masochists. Mountain biking started out long before telescoping forks and complex linkage designs, but the bikes of those early days are now a far cry from the activity most consider “mountain biking”. Of course, those weirdos, quacks, and masochists still have a place in this world, and it turns out I’m one of them. It wasn’t always this way. I used to ride and write about my experience with suspension…
